By now you'd be aware that Melbourne has retained her crown as the world's most liveable city for the sixth year running, granting Victorians full bragging rights for at least the next 12 months.
The Victorian capital beat out 140 of the world's major cities in the annual Economist Intelligence Unit (EIU) global liveability survey, taking out the top spot and narrowly beating Vienna and Vancouver.

Sadly, Sydney failed to retain its top ten status, dropping to eleventh place while Adelaide and Perth came in at sixth and seventh place respectively.
The EUI index scores each city in healthcare, education, stability, culture, environment and infrastructure, but these pictures alone prove the pure grace of the modest East Coast city.
